| 0:00.0 | Hi, everyone. It's 4 o'clock in New York. Donald Trump's handpick U.S. Attorney, |
| 0:09.0 | Janine Piro, fought the law, and in this instance, the law won. We come on the air with the breaking news that a federal judge today derailed the case. |
| 0:18.7 | Piro has been trying to assemble against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ell. |
| 0:23.1 | Judge James Bosberg blocked the subpoenas served to the Federal Reserve regarding its building |
| 0:28.3 | renovation, writing in his ruling this, quote, a mountain of evidence suggests that the government |
| 0:33.9 | served these subpoenas to pressure Powell into voting for lower interest rates |
| 0:38.3 | or resigning. Judge Bosberg said Piro's office, quote, has produced essentially zero evidence |
| 0:45.0 | to suspect Chair Powell of a crime. Indeed, its justifications are so thin and unsubstantiated that |
| 0:51.6 | the court can only conclude that they are pretextual. |
| 0:55.2 | The court therefore finds that the subpoenas were issued for an improper purpose and will quash |
| 1:00.4 | them. In a press conference a few minutes ago, Piro tried to save face. She accused Judge |
| 1:05.8 | Bozberg of showing a bias against Donald Trump. She also added that she will appeal this decision by Judge |
| 1:11.6 | Bozberg. This stinging blow to her case is just the latest rebuke and defeat for the Trump |
| 1:17.8 | DOJ as it pursues anyone Donald Trump places on his enemies list for investigation and prosecution. |
| 1:25.1 | That pattern did not go unnoticed by Judge Boasberg in his ruling when he wrote |
| 1:29.4 | this, quote, being perceived as the president's adversary has become risky in recent years. In his |
| 1:35.3 | second term, Trump has urged the Department of Justice to prosecute such people, and the department's |
| 1:41.1 | prosecutors have listened. For instance, the president exhorted the attorney general to prosecute Jim Comey, Adam Schiff, and Letitia James. |
| 1:49.9 | Consistent with this pattern, DOJ now set its sights on Powell. |
